REAL TIME RSS BASED ADAPTIVE BEAM STEERING ALGORITHM FOR AUTONOMOUS VEHICLES
2014
Progress In Electromagnetics Research C
A real time, low complexity algorithm is developed to steer a planar patch antenna array beam to the maximum received signal strength (RSS) direction for communication link enhancement. The beam steering towards the maximum incoming signal direction is based on an iterative technique utilizing a set of RSS measurements taken from specific locations in the search space, these locations collectively form an ellipse.
